Council accepts city annual financial report after clean audit; Stevens Plantation compliance remains unresolved
Summary
The council accepted the city's Annual Comprehensive Financial Report after independent auditors issued an unmodified (clean) opinion. Auditors noted no material weaknesses but flagged an ongoing compliance issue tied to Stevens Plantation; staff said negotiations with bondholders are ongoing.
City auditors from Pervis Gray and Company reported a clean, unmodified opinion on the City of St. Cloud's fiscal‑year 2023–24 financial statements, and the City Council voted to accept the Annual Comprehensive Financial Report (ACFR).
